About Us

The dictionary defines a manifesto as a public declaration of intent, policy and aims as issued by a political party, government or movement. This section of our website provides just that – a clear statement of our principles and an insight to our company and services. If you have not worked with us before, we hope these […]

Latest News

Two Weeks into Lockdown

An update on what we’ve been doing at Excellimore to help our clients keep working during the coronavirus pandemic.